First of all, FairEmail’s main goal is to help you protect your privacy. What follows is a complete overview of all the data that can be sent to the internet, which in the end is always your choice and therefore optional (except of course connecting to the email server).

Except for error reports (disabled by default), the app does not send any data to the developer. Error reports will automatically be deleted after one month, or earlier upon request.

Data will never be sold or shared in any way.

The data safety in the Play Store says:

+

The developer says this app doesn’t share user data with other companies or organizations.”.

+

Unfortunately, there is no way to say that the app doesn’t share data with the developer. Except for error reporting (explicitly opt-in) no data will be shared with the developer. It is important to note that collecting data on the device isn’t synonymous with sending data off the device!


Overview

FairEmail does not send account information and message data elsewhere than to your email provider.
